Invoice factoring allows you to sell your outstanding invoices to a factoring company in exchange for immediate cash. You submit your invoices, and the factor advances you up to 90% of the invoice value within 24 hours. When your customer pays the invoice, the factor releases the remaining balance minus a small fee. For Salem, Oregon B2B businesses waiting 30, 60, or 90 days for customer payment, factoring turns your receivables into immediate working capital.
No. Invoice factoring is not a loan — it is the sale of an asset (your invoice). You are not borrowing money and creating debt on your balance sheet. You are simply accelerating payment on money you have already earned. This means there is no monthly payment, no interest accumulating, and no impact on your credit. Factoring fees typically range from 1% to 5% of the invoice value per 30 days. The exact rate depends on your industry, your customers' creditworthiness, the invoice amount, and how long it takes your customers to pay. For example, if you factor a $10,000 invoice with a 2% monthly fee and your customer pays in 30 days, the cost is $200. It depends on the type of factoring. With notification factoring, your customers are informed and pay the factor directly. With non-notification factoring, the process is handled discreetly. Most B2B factoring is notification-based because it is more cost-effective. No. Spot factoring allows you to factor individual invoices as needed, giving you maximum flexibility. Whole-ledger factoring requires you to factor all invoices from specific customers. This depends on whether you choose recourse or non-recourse factoring. With recourse factoring, you are responsible if your customer does not pay, and you must buy back the invoice. With non-recourse factoring, the factor assumes the credit risk and you are not liable for non-payment. Non-recourse factoring costs more but offers greater protection.
